Window AC Unit Amp Draw

The current draw, or amp draw, of a window AC unit refers to the amount of electrical current it consumes while operating. This specification is crucial for ensuring the unit is compatible with the electrical circuit and wiring in your home. Understanding the amp draw requirements helps prevent overloading circuits, tripping breakers, or causing electrical hazards. Electricians can assess and verify the electrical capacity for safe and efficient installation.

Current Draw: The Invisible Force

Current draw refers to the flow of electrons through your electrical unit. It’s measured in amperes (A), and it’s a crucial factor in determining the unit’s power consumption and efficiency. A higher current draw means more electrons are flowing, which can increase the unit’s energy usage and heat output.

Implications of a Zappy Appetite

If your unit’s current draw is too high, it can:

  • Stress electrical components, leading to reduced lifespan and potential failures.
  • Overload circuits, causing popping breakers or sizzling wires, which can be dangerous and disruptive.
  • Increase energy bills, as more electricity is being devoured to satisfy the unit’s electrical gluttony.

Electrical Specifications: The Nitty-Gritty You Need to Know

When it comes to electrical devices, understanding their specifications is like having the secret decoder ring to the world of electricity. It’s the key to unlocking the mysteries of power, current, and voltage.

  • Voltage: This is like the speed limit for electricity. Too much voltage, and things get zappy. Too little, and they just sit there, like an indecisive robot.

  • Current: Current is the flow of electrons, like a rushing river of electricity. It’s measured in amps, and it’s what powers up your devices.

  • Power: Power is the product of voltage and current, so it’s like the horsepower of electricity. It’s measured in watts, and it tells you how much electricity your device is using.
